Get ready to climb some long hard pitches for more than just a day with The North Face's Fulcrum 35 Backpack, a climb-worthy pack designed with a combination of sturdy ballistics nylon and lightweight automobile airbag fabric. Stash your ropes easily in the double vertical front zips and haul your bag up and over cliffs without trouble via the reinforced 3-point haul loops.
Features:
- Carry your gear up crags with a pack body designed just for climbing gear with tough ballistics nylon fitted with tough automobile airbag fabric panels to reduce weight and welded abrasion-resistant fabric reinforcements
- Never deal with cold clammy sweat thanks to the molded E-VAP back panel that allows moisture to evaporate quickly through its perforated foam
- Balance your load across your hips with the stowable padded hipbelt with gear loops for carrying an extra biner or two
- Stow your ropes easily via the double vertical front zips, carry your H2O in the inward expanding side water-bottle packet that doesn't protrude in tight sports
- Haul your gear up long pitches with the help of the reinforced 3-point haul loops, all while you keep extra gear clipped or tied to the multiple exterior lash points
- If you need more than water bottles, carry your H2O bladder in this hydration-compatible pack that has a simple hose port for easy access
- Don't worry about your stuff getting wet - weather-resistant PU zips keep drizzles and showers out
- Up your safety with the Safe-T whistle attached to the sliding sternum strap and the reflective hits that make you more visible to others in dark conditions
Specifications:
- Capacity: 2200 cu in
- Weight: 2 lb 7 oz
- Material: 315D Cordura nylon / 630D ballistics nylon
- Access: top
- Number of pockets: main compartment +1 pocket
